Sacbrood bee virus (SBV))is a wildly spread honey bee virus around the world. Thepathogen of sacbrood bee disease is a kind of linear single stranded RNA virus that with around-hexagon envelop from28~30nm diameter. Because western honey bees owns ahigher resistances to SBV, so they can cure themselves after infected by SBV. SBV won’tcourse severe commercial loses. For eastern honey bees, they were very sensitive to sacbroodvirus, so once the Chinese sacbrood bee virus(CSBV) infected Chinese bees, it becomepandemic, and coursed serious economic loss.In this study we investigated the occurrences of CSBV in loess plateau including Shaanxi,Ningxia, Shanxi, Gansu provinces from20th centuries. Also we invented a new identificationtechnique——gradient band PCR method and put it into firstly application. The mainlyresults in this research are as follows:(1) There are three pandemic of CSBV from1970s till nowadays in loess plateau. The firstpandemic was in early1970s, the second one was taken from late1980s to early1990s andlast one happened in these5to8years. CSBV coursed one of the most severe disease thatconstituted an obstacle to our native honey bee industry, they often causes enormous losses toswarms.(2) A novel method for identification of CSBV, Gradient band PCR (GBP) was set up inthis study. Compared with traditional RT-PCR, this new identification method was very quickand easily manipulated, which provided another method to diagnosis and control the Chinesehoneybee sacbrood. The healthy samples and CSBV infected bee larvae from south ofShaanxi, north of Shaanxi and middle of Shaanxi was confirmed by both of traditionalRT-PCR and gradient band PCR, respectively. The PCR products was observed by AGE andthen sent for sequencing. The results showed that the identification accuracy were the same byboth RT-PCR and GBP, and the GBP method was a very quick, convenient and comparativelyeasy approach that could identify the virus without the results of PCR product sequences.
